The Basics Of Distillation Process In Water Treatment System

In the water treatment system, distillation is one of the most important processes in keeping water free from contamination.

The process makes water conducive for drinking or other special applications.

The distillation units remove contaminants such as toxic metals, dissolved solids, and inorganic materials.

Getting a quality distillation device from a renowned and reputable manufacturer makes water treatment system effective.

Working Principles

The working principle in the process of distillation of water is as follows:

1. Water is diverted from the water distribution system in the house into the boiling chamber.

2. The water is heated to boil to produce steam.

3. The steam is then channeled into a condenser. This is where the steam condenses. There is the treatment of water to remove toxic materials and other harmful substances here.

4. The distilled water is passed into a storage tank for use.

Important Things To Consider During Distillation

The following things are very important to consider in the distillation process of water in the water treatment system.

1. Corrosion-free components

The removal of dissolved solids from water can make the water corrosive.

The use of corrosion-free materials as a storage tank as well as distillation components are very important.

Also, the distribution system from the household water should not be corrosive.

2. Presence of Volatile and Semi-volatile compounds

Some volatile and semi-volatile compounds may not be eliminated during distillation. In case there is a presence of any of them, it should be removed before distillation.

How To Remove Volatile Organic Compounds(VOCs)

To remove volatile organic compounds from water, preheat the water.

This should be done in the vented part of the distillation device.

The volatile organic compound will escape before putting it in the boiling chamber.

In case there is the presence of an undesired organic compound in the distilled water, post-treat the water with an activated carbon device. This will remove the undesired compound.

3. Maintenance

Irrespective of the type of distiller you purchase for the distillation of water, good maintenance is very important.

The operation should be as recommended by the manufacturer.

Proper operation, cleaning, and repair/replacement of parts should be taken very importantly.

There should be a logbook that records water test results, repairs, and maintenance dates.

The ozonation process

This critical process that leads to the production of ozonated water takes place naturally and can be induced in a water treatment system.

This occurs when water molecules are exposed to UV radiation; the radiation splits the oxygen molecules in water into two, making them reactive enough to form ozone.  

Once ozone is produced in water, it mops up all impurities; this is because it is a very toxic and reactive gas.  

It is meant for the atmosphere and therefore eliminates all microorganisms, which could affect human health.

Once the ozonated water is exposed to excess oxygen, the ozone gas is reverted back to oxygen, making the water very safe for consumption.

The Merits of Ozonation

Ø The ozonation process very effective than chlorinated and is not affected by the pH of the water

Ø With this process, you don’t need to add chemicals to the water to get it treated. 

Ø It eradicates all impurities and totally eliminates all taste and odour issues.

Ø It takes a little time, and your water is pure and fit for drinking.  

Demerits of Ozonation

Ø The ozonation process is highly expensive in terms of operational and maintenance costs.

Ø It requires very special mixing skills since ozone is not readily soluble, unlike chlorine.

Ø Since ozonation has no residual effect, the possibility of re-contamination of the water is very high. 

Ø Care must be taken during this process to avoid fire and poisoning episodes since ozone is a very toxic gas.  

Ø The by-products of this process are suspected to be carcinogens; however, research is still on to validate this claim. Also, getting a water treatment system with an activated carbon system will eradicate these products and make you worry less about their effects.

Production Process of the Gallon Water Filling Machine

The following steps will give you a deeper understanding of the production process of the Gallon water filling machine.

· The empty barrels are conveyed properly using the conveying belt into the decapping machine

· The decapping machine removes the bottles caps

· The bottle caps are cleaned, disinfected, and recycled.

· The conveyor conveys the barrel into the external washing machine with a brush. The brush washing machine properly rinses the barrel with pure water and hot alkali.

· The barrels are sent to the filling capping machine for rinsing of the inside with disinfectant liquid, hot alkali, and pure water.

· The barrel is then filled with pure water that is provided by the water treatment system.

Basic Functions Of Ion Exchange Resins In A Water Treatment System

A water treatment system is one of the most widely used process that is employed for various use in most industrial organizations.

Among the various components that makes up this handy and useful system, ion exchange resin is one of them with a tremendous functions.

As a result of the effectiveness of this component of water system, they have been used in the treatment of water for so many years.

In most cases, the most notable application of the ion exchange resin is in the softening of water. However, they also have other industrial applications other than in the softening of water.

Specifically, ion exchange resins are used in the reduction of the amount of nitrates, perchlorate, arsenic, uranium and a whole lot of other compounds and elements in water.

More so, ion exchange resin also function in the complete deionization of water for the removal any mineral content that may be present in it.

Due to the high relevance of ion the exchange resin to the overall performance of a water treatment system, it is therefore a wise decision to partner with a reliable manufacturer for the best products at any time.

However, in this article, we shall be walking you through some of the most common types of ion exchange resin as well as their uses in a water treatment system.

1. Strong Acid Cation (SAC)

The strong acid cation resin is used majorly for water softening. In addition to the softening of water, it also serves very well in the reduction of iron in water. Apart from this strong acid cation also helps in the complete removal of radium and barium in water, and finally, the strong acid cation serves the purpose of exchanging for sodium ions.

2. Weak Acid Cation (WAC)

Just like its counterpart, the weak acid cation resin also function in the softening of water through the removal of magnesium and calcium. Besides this, the weak acid cation also help in slight reduction of total dissolved solids (TDS) in a water treatment system.

In addition to the above functions, WAC also helps in the reduction of alkalinity in water. However, it has one undesirable effect, which is the reduction of the pH level.

3. Strong Base Anion (SBA)

The strong base anion helps in the reduction of arsenic, nitrates, perchlorate, uranium and total organic carbon (TOC). They can also be employed as an antimicrobial compound.

4. Strong Acid Cation (SAC) and Strong Base Anion (SBA) together

Some other types of ion exchange resin known as the SAC and SBA are usually used either together or individually in the reduction of TDS and minerals in water.

During the use of SAC and SBC in the softening of water, the process is usually referred to as demineralization or deionization (DI).
